Hey team — handing off the Parcelwing webhook before I'm out next week. Short version: Driftmark's tracking events sometimes arrive out of order, so the handler buffers for 30 seconds before updating shipment status. If a customer says their parcel is "stuck," it's usually just the buffer. Retries are automatic; don't replay events manually. Everything else you'd want, including the event reference and known quirks, lives on the page linked below.

wiki page, tahaf-tajog: https://jira.ordindyn.corp/pipeline

**Ticket: Config drift — Spoolwright print service**

For new folks: Spoolwright nodes in the east cluster are running a stale queue-depth setting after last month's manual patch. Jobs stall when the spooler hits the old limit. Do not edit node configs directly; changes go through the manifest repo. The intended settings, which east currently does not match, are these.

config for tawif-bagef:
[sorwyn]
team = sorys
access_code = ac_9ba40c
host = sorwyn.ordingrid.local
port = 5000
owner = aldok.quenion
peer = belath.paliqcloud.local

Quick note for the sync: date localization in Ledgewick now routes through the Calendrix service rather than per-app formatting tables. Calendrix resolves locale, calendar system, and timezone in one call, which removes the drift we saw between the Fernby mobile and web clients. All environments call the internal endpoint with authentication required. For local testing, the service accepts the key included below.

API key for yahig-tadup: kto7_ubizbYm